Job Title: Production Worker

Job Description

The production worker will take on a versatile role involving the loading and stacking of materials onto and off the production line. Responsibilities include performing visual quality inspections, cutting tiles to size, and palletizing finished tiles. While most tiles weigh around 2 pounds, some may be heavier due to additional applications. The ability to lift up to 50 pounds independently is required, with team lifting for anything above.

Work in a very clean environment that is not climate controlled, which may be warm during the summer months. Employees will be working with fiberglass, which requires sensitivity awareness. Personal protective equipment (PPE) is provided to cover arms and neck to prevent fiberglass irritation. The use of gloves, earplugs, and safety glasses is mandatory.
